System Troubleshooting

Hard Alarms: The following give a constant audible alarm. If present, the solenoid
valve is closed, and the 4-20, remote alarm and ethernet modules transmit the alarm.
System Display
Problem
The system has detected a
problem with the lamp.
Although the lamp is
powered and visibly
illuminated, due to the
lamp's age its UV output
is no longer sufficient for
proper disinfection.
Low UV Intensity.
Wrong lamp or sensor
installed.
The UV sensor is no longer
communicating to with the
system.
A bad connection has been
detected in the IEP port.
Missing or incorrect lamp
key.

Resolution
Reset lamp protection
circuit – unplug unit for
10 seconds. Replace
the lamp with the part as
indicated on the silver label
on the reactor or on the
Maintenance parts screen.
Replace the lamp with the
part as indicated on the
silver label on the reactor or
on the Maintenance parts
screen.
Remove and clean the
quartz sleeve and sensor.
Check water quality meets
requirements on page
5 and add filtration as
required. Replace lamp.
Replace component with
proper model as indicated.
Ensure all modules are
connected properly to the
system and to each other.
Modules can be tested
individually by plugging in
one at a time and cycling
power to the system.
Replace any module that is
not detected when plugged
directly into the controller.
Ensure the lamp key
(packed with the lamp, on
the connector) is installed.
Unplug and reinstall the
key. Ensure the key part
number matches Lamp on
Mainte-nance Parts screen.
